    abstract = {A total of 106 samples including parsley, lettuce, cress, watercress, mint and dill were analyzed for <I>Staphylococcus aureus </I>and Coagulase Negative Staphylococci (CNS). According to microbiological analyses, <I>Staphylococcus aureus </I>and the CNS were found in 8 (7.55%) and 48 (45.28%) samples, respectively. The CNS were identified  as <I> S.  epidermidis </I> 10 (9.43%), <I>S. arlettae </I>9 (8.49%), <I>S. xylosus </I>8 (7.55%), <I>S. sciuri </I>6 (5.66%), <I>S. simulans </I>4 (3.77%), <I>S. lentus </I>3 (2.83%), <I>S. equorum </I>3 (2.83%), <I>S. warneri </I>3 (2.83%), <I>S. saprophyticus</I> 1 (0.94%) and <I>S. haemolyticus </I>1 (0.94%).}
